Nestle wants to double its capacity in Indonesia.

source: sahabatnestle.co.id


The company inaugurated the USD 100 million expansion of its milk processing facilities in Kejayan, East Java.

Thanks to this step, this facility will become one of Nestle’s ten largest milk-processing plants in the world and will significantly increase Nestle’s fresh milk intake from local dairy farmers from approximately 620 000 litres per day to more than one million litres per day in the next few years.

It is known that the factory will produce under the popular milk brands Lactogen and Dancow.
